Welcome! Log In Create A New Profile

Advanced

header filter chain

Vitaly Kushner
October 05, 2010 05:34AM
Я пробую добавить мой филтр в "цепь" header filter. я делаю это из postconfig:

static ngx_int_t
mod_py_postconfig(ngx_conf_t *cf)
{
ngx_http_next_header_filter = ngx_http_top_header_filter;
ngx_http_top_header_filter = mod_py_headers_filter;

return NGX_OK;
}

проблема в том что postconfig из ngx_http_header_filter_module
вызывается после моего и игнорирует значение
ngx_http_top_header_filter:

static ngx_int_t
ngx_http_header_filter_init(ngx_conf_t *cf)
{
ngx_http_top_header_filter = ngx_http_header_filter;

return NGX_OK;
}

я могу руками поправить порядок вызова в objs/ngx_modules.c но это
коряво и придёться это делать после каждого вызова ./configure

идеи?

--
Vitaly Kushner
http://twitter.com/vkushner
Founder, Astrails Ltd. http://astrails.com/
Check out our blog: http://blog.astrails.com/
_______________________________________________
nginx-ru mailing list
nginx-ru@nginx.org
http://nginx.org/mailman/listinfo/nginx-ru
Subject Author Posted

header filter chain

Vitaly Kushner October 05, 2010 05:34AM

Re: header filter chain

Valery Kholodkov October 05, 2010 05:50AM



Sorry, only registered users may post in this forum.

Click here to login

Online Users

Guests: 150
Record Number of Users: 8 on April 13, 2023
Record Number of Guests: 421 on December 02, 2018
Powered by nginx      Powered by FreeBSD      PHP Powered      Powered by MariaDB      ipv6 ready